Jacksonville Public Library Director Barbara Gubbin (center) got a nice end-of-April present Wednesday in the form of a $150,000 check from the Friends of the Public Library. The money was raised during the recent book sale at the Fairgrounds. Friends President Jackie Nash and Chair of Library’s Board of Trustees Bill Scheu presented both the oversized and real check to Gubbin. Nash said the money will help offset budget cuts from the state and go to programs such as murals and “Book Bunches” which helps people establish book clubs.
